Measurements
Cumulative or differential particle counts
Environmental parameters via DDE (e.g., temperature, relative humidity, differential pressure, air velocity, closed/open sensors, etc.)
Calculations of Log removal, beta ratio, percent difference, count concentration, dilution scaling, flow rate scaling, difference, and sum
Statistical reductions of measurements: average, minimum, maximum, and standard deviation
Manual input of values from "virtual" sensors for data entry from off-line devices such as laboratory instruments, manually controlled dilution systems, or microscope and chemical tests
Monitoring of process control signals via DDE or particle counter analog inputs to automatically set Out-of-Service and Process profiling software states; Out-of-Service can also be set manually on-screen; Software can also generate control output signals to control your process or facility
The Measurements Explorer display uses the standard Windows Explorer metaphor to reveal the status and critical value for each measured location in your facility/process

Alarming
Four alarm levels for each measurement
User-selectable alarm delays and automatic acknowledge after specified time period
Statistical alarms using online statistical measurements
Alarm notes and acknowledgement tracking including "acknowledged by", reason, when acknowledged, length of time to acknowledgement, etc.
Alarm light/siren control, including grouping alarms per annunciator and controlling annunciator behavior based on acknowledgement and alarm state.

Three Editions of Particle Vision Online

Small System Edition: Perfect as a low-cost small monitoring system, with connections for a few alarm annunciators and environmental sensors. Primarily, the Small System Edition is a particle counting system for 16 locations.

Standard Edition: This edition is a full SCADA system that operates on a single computer. With a large capacity for 64 particle counter locations and unlimited DDE connections for environmental sensors and PLCs, this edition has the capacity for most monitoring needs. Standard Edition provides advanced monitoring capabilities such as statistical measurements and Smart Monitoring©, which adjusts data storage based on data events/trends or the process state.

Enterprise Edition: This edition is capable of monitoring a complete enterprise with multiple facilities in different geographic locations (WAN). Enterprise Edition can also be used on a local area network inside a single facility (LAN). The number of client computers (i.e. view stations) is unlimited. For systems with hundreds of particle counter instruments, this edition offers unlimited sensor capacity, plus all the features of the Standard Edition.
